How do I enroll my child?
Find your school on the Schools page, then click ‘Enroll Now.’ Registration is handled through Arly — you’ll create an account, pick your program and schedule, and complete payment online. The whole thing takes less than five minutes and your spot is confirmed right away.
What does my child do in the program each day?
Every day includes homework time, a snack, enrichment activities, and time to move. Depending on the location and grade level, kids can choose from STEAM projects, arts, fitness challenges, outdoor play, and student-choice clubs. It’s structured enough to be productive and fun enough that kids don’t want to leave.
Is a snack provided?
Yes — a daily snack is included at all Club BX locations. Students are welcome to bring their own nut-free snacks if they prefer. All surfaces are cleaned before and after snack time.
Who are the staff?
All Club BX staff are recruited, hired, and trained directly by Club BX. Everyone goes through fingerprinted background checks before their first day. Staff wear branded Club BX gear and identification badges so they’re always easy to identify.

How does pickup and check-out work?
Authorized adults are listed during enrollment in Arly. At pickup, staff verify identity before a child is released.
